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ority in Positive Store Culture roles?
Entry‑level positions such as Customer Experience Associate start around $30k–$38k. Mid‑level roles like Store Operations Analyst or Visual Merchandiser range $45k–$65k. Senior positions, including Store Manager or Retail Operations Director, typically earn $70k–$100k, with top executives in larger chains reaching $120k+.
Which skills and certifications are required for Positive Store Culture positions?
Core skills include POS proficiency (Shopify POS, Lightspeed, Square), data analysis (Tableau, Power BI), and customer‑centric communication. Certifications such as Certified Retail Management Professional (CRMP), Certified Retail Analytics Professional (CRAP), and SAP Retail or Microsoft Dynamics 365 Retail credentials give a competitive edge.
Is remote work available for Positive Store Culture roles?
Most frontline positions require on‑site presence, but tech‑focused roles—Technology Integration Coordinator, Retail Analytics Specialist, and Inventory Optimization Analyst—can be hybrid or fully remote, especially when remote support for POS and e‑commerce platforms is needed.
What career progression paths exist within Positive Store Culture?
A typical path moves from Associate to Supervisor, then to Store Manager, followed by Regional Operations Manager, and finally to Director of Retail Operations or VP of Customer Experience. Continuous learning through retail‑specific certifications accelerates promotion.
What industry trends are shaping Positive Store Culture today?
Omni‑channel integration, AI‑driven inventory management, smart shelf IoT, sustainable merchandising, and inclusive hiring practices are reshaping the retail landscape. Companies that adopt these trends attract top talent and improve customer loyalty.
